Шаг 4. Приёмники широковещательных намерений
Добавлено: 26 ноя 2012, 20:09
Данный компонент предназначен для получения оповещений о событиях, вырабатываемых системой, либо сторонними приложениями.
Например, это могут быть события подключения к Wi-Fi точке доступа, низком заряде батареи и т.п.
Все приемники широковещательных намерений наследуются от класса BroadcastReceiver.
Как и сервисы, приемники событий не имеют пользовательского интерфейса. Тем не менее приемник может осуществить запуск деятельности при получении события, либо оповестить пользователя сообщением в области уведомлений.
Приемник широковещательных намерений содержит только один метод обратного вызова:
Приемник широковещательных событий считается активным только во время выполнения данного метода. В это время процесс с приемником широковещательного события не может быть уничтожен.
Например, это могут быть события подключения к Wi-Fi точке доступа, низком заряде батареи и т.п.
Все приемники широковещательных намерений наследуются от класса BroadcastReceiver.
Как и сервисы, приемники событий не имеют пользовательского интерфейса. Тем не менее приемник может осуществить запуск деятельности при получении события, либо оповестить пользователя сообщением в области уведомлений.
Приемник широковещательных намерений содержит только один метод обратного вызова:
- Код: выделить все
onReceive().
Приемник широковещательных событий считается активным только во время выполнения данного метода. В это время процесс с приемником широковещательного события не может быть уничтожен.